Review: 'Campbell, Ruu'
'Heartsong'   

-  Album: 'Heartsong'
-  Genre: 'Folk' -  Release Date: '25th August 2014'

Our Rating:
What’s immediately striking about the debut album from one-time Leftfield vocalist Ruu Campbell is just how delicate and considered it is. Campbell effortlessly moves between moods, soft and airy verses transition to darker, brooding middle eights in this set of gentle, elegant songs.

‘Crossroads’ has a dark psychedelic edge and forges a quietly claustrophobic atmosphere, while ‘There is a Place’ has an ethereal, almost religious ambience, not to mention strong echoes of Nick Drake.

With mournful strings and fluttering flute overlaying a delicately picked guitar and Campbell’s haunting vocal, closer ‘Crystalline’ is a remarkably powerful and truly captivating song that encapsulates the beautifully ponderous qualities of the album as a whole. A great achievement indeed.
